在前端开发中,我们经常需要动态地向HTML文档中添加新的元素。这时,`appendChild()` 和 `insertBefore()` 方法就派上了用场。这两个方法都是用来向DOM(文档对象模型)中插入新元素的,但它们的操作方式有所不同。🚀
首先,`appendChild()` 方法用于将一个子节点添加到指定父节点的末尾。这就像把一个新的朋友介绍给你的朋友圈,让这个新朋友成为你朋友圈中的一员,但总是排在最后一位。🎈
而 `insertBefore()` 方法则更加灵活,它允许你在指定的已有兄弟节点之前插入一个新节点。想象一下,当你有一个已有的朋友圈,你可以选择在任何一位朋友之前介绍你的新朋友,让他/她成为这个位置的新成员。🌟
通过这两种方法的不同使用场景,我们可以更高效地管理和更新我们的网页内容。掌握它们的使用技巧,可以让我们的网站更加生动有趣!✨
JavaScript DOM操作 网页开发